Accessibility Resources for Students (ARS) is here to answer your questions about procedures for registering with us; disability documentation; and academic, housing, and dietary accommodations. We encourage you to connect with our team to learn more about the supports and services available through ARS:
- Your access advisor can help you navigate accommodations, explore assistive technologies, and access resources that promote equitable participation in the Berklee experience.
- Our academic coaches partner with you to strengthen learning strategies and develop skills for academic success.
- If you are interested in neurodiversity-focused support can also connect with our neurodiversity program manager to learn more about MIND@Berklee, participate in specialized programming, and explore individualized coaching opportunities.

Enrolled Undergraduate Students
To schedule an appointment, go to the Berklee Bridge Portal and click the “Connect” button next to your dedicated access advisor’s name.
Graduate Students and Non-Enrolled Students
Students who are on leave, returning, or entering may meet with any access advisor.

Meeting Location
- In-person meetings are held in the Center for Student Success located at 939 Boylston Street (accessible via 921 Boylston Street, third floor).
- Virtual meetings are also available for all students. If you schedule a virtual meeting, you will receive an email invitation that includes a link to join the Zoom meeting at your scheduled time.
